Cup of Zwartsluis in the collection of the Royal Antiquarian Society, 1877 Silver Cup, donated by H. Bentinck, Sheriff van Vollenhoven, to Zwartsluis in 1676. Bokaal, silver with lid, decorated with gearing on the cuppa the allegories of War, peace and security with appropriate poems. The cup was in 1864 owned by the Royal Antiquarian Society that his museum opende. Manufacturer on October 27, 1877: Photographer: Peter Oosterhuis Place manufacture: Netherlands Date: 1864 - 1867 Physical features: albumen print material: paper paper cardboard Technique: albumen print dimensions: photo: H 210 mm × b 124 mm Subject: chalicepiece of sculpture, reproduction of a piece of sculpture as: 1877 - 1877
